Uncle Funk's Disco Inferno return to Bourne Corn Exchange!

Chris

7/23/2024 12:34:19 PM

Entertainment

4 mins read

Grab your feather boas and strap on your boogie shoes! Uncle Funk’s Disco Inferno are returning to Bourne Corn Exchange after their amazing show last October.

 

Renowned for their dynamic stage presence and electrifying renditions of the classic hits of the disco era including Earth, Wind & Fire, Chic, Kool & The Gang, Sister Sledge and many, many more.  
The 9 piece live band are set to bring their unparalleled energy and unmistakable style to the Bourne venue on Saturday September 28th


Fans can expect a night filled with timeless disco classics and irresistible dancefloor hits, and are encouraged to dress to excess!

 

“We’re thrilled to be returning to Bourne” said Uncle Funk, the band’s charismatic frontman. “This may be our only show in the town this year, so get ready to dance, sing along, and let loose as we bring the magic of disco to life!”



Uncle Funk’s Disco Inferno have recently played the main stage at Cambridge Club Festival 2024 on a bill featuring soul legend Chaka Khan along with the Earth, Wind & Fire Experience, Sister Sledge, Incognito and many more.

 

They also appreared at London’s Indigo O2 on earlier this year with Sybil and Heather Small from M People and Phil Fearon’s Galaxy.


“We are very lucky that we get the opportunity to play these massive events with some of the legends of the disco era. It’s a testament to this amazing band that we are considered worthy of sharing bills with these artists”
